How to Get Your $8000 Tax Credit


For all those of you who have done your part to provide a stimulus to the U.S. economy by buying your first home...let's take a look at ways for you to get the tax credit to which you are entitled.

There are a couple of ways depending upon when you would like to receive the tax credit. First if you would like to receive it in the near future then you can amend your 2008 return using a few easy steps that are detailed in the link below:

And for those of you who are sitting on the fence...it's time to jump into the game. The tax credit is only applicable to first time home buyers who purchase AND CLOSE by December 1st, 2009. Also, rules have changed so that you can use the tax credit as your actual downpayment. So give us a call so we can get the ball rolling!!!
